Chapter 482 - Chapter 482: Aftermath

A few days later, Nero had reached the private and entirely unpoetic conclusion that anyone who spoke reverently about first rut had either never experienced one or deserved to.

The fever had finally broken, the sharpest edge of his pheromones no longer turned the recovery wing into a controlled disaster zone, and the physicians had stopped moving around him with the strained caution of people working beside unstable explosives. That, apparently, qualified as improvement. 

Nero personally thought it qualified only as proof that hell had a recovery room.

He lay half-reclined against the raised bed, one knee bent beneath the sheet, staring at the muted city beyond the reinforced glass while the remains of the heat lingered under his skin in a way he found unpleasant.
